HOOT! Wins the GA Let's Dance Contest
One of the things I like most about Go!Animate is that they run weekly contests on a variety of topics usually giving users about 24 hours to get in an entry. I really like the challenge of the time constraint as it forces me to think up something and stick to it---as opposed to my ever changing mind jumping around while I work off the cuff---which I also like to do.
Anyhoo, the contest my HOOT! animation won was for NATIONAL DANCE DAY IN THE US (being July 31). I quickly anagrammed the theme phrase and found AHOY! LAND INSTANT AUDIENCE. So seeing how I love the MOON and HOOT can fly---why not get a couple of characters up there to show off
their dance moves in celebration of the national event.
Hope you guys enjoy---pass the it along if you think others will get a kick out of it.

Introducting Hoot - The Owl that likes to Anagram
Hoot's Beginnings
Always being in awe of the words that can be made with the letters comprising other words---I always wanted a way that would creatively show, and tell, how both Anagrams and Lexigrams seem to have their own way of telling the truth about their subject.
In April of 2010, I happened upon Go!Animate.com and through its cartooning platform with alittle help from one of its top animators---
----I was saw my Hoot off paper and come alive in a cartoon. It was a remarkable moment for me. As Hoot's mental birth came to me back in 2008 when I stumbled with the techniques I was learning how to do Stop Motion video.
One of GoAnimates cartoonist, named The Extraordinary Tourist, brought Hoot to life for me from my original drawings of him and his special home in a big green tree and gave him his new home on GoAnimate.com.
I'm hoping that my blog readers will enjoy watching my Hoot! cartoons as much as I have enjoyed making them.
Here is Hoot!'s first cartoon after TeT aka: the eTourist aka: The Exordinary Tourist aka: South Austrialian Artist David Arandle. I plan on sharing soon some of TET's amazing cartoons. Hoping you get inspired to create a cartoon of your own, here's Hoot!
